I have had a problem (well sort of a problem) .. when i would start my car in the morning it will start every time but every now and then i would hear a sort of metal on metal sound instantly after the car is started. Now in the morning it does this everytime. However if i would say .. goto the store and turn off the car and come back out it will start right up perfectly. Only seems to make the sound after the car has rested for a while. Does this sound like the starter? im going to test the battery. Also my battery cable are kind of chewed up i plan on replacing those.

any other ideas?
 
how old is the starter? It could be the spur gear is not retracting fully after power is no longer applied to the starter. A new solenoid at the starter could resolve it.

You could verify this by removing the starter and inspecting the spur gear for signs of damage from nicking the flywheel gears.
